Which is better for beginners — Les Deux Alpes or Portillo?

Portillo is the better pick for beginners. It dedicates more of its mountain to green runs and easy terrain, which means less time hunting for appropriate slopes and more time building confidence.

Which resort gets more snow — Les Deux Alpes or Portillo?

Les Deux Alpes (508 cm/year) and Portillo (500 cm/year) receive similar annual snowfall. Neither has a meaningful snow advantage — other factors like aspect, elevation, and grooming matter more day-to-day.

Which mountain is bigger — Les Deux Alpes or Portillo?

Les Deux Alpes is the larger mountain by trail count (Les Deux Alpes: 220 trails, Portillo: 35 trails). On a week-long trip, a bigger mountain means more variety and a lower chance of feeling like you've exhausted the terrain.
